Enjoy Lithuanian history and tradition in the Merkine Manor

The historical site was recently leased to a new company, which aims to develop it in the perfect tourist spot

The Varena District Municipality recently signed a forty-year lease with the local soap factory for the maintaining of one of Lithuania’s most famous and most visited historical landmarks. The Merkine Manor combined the perfect landscape with vast historical heritage. Located near the village of Dzukija, it boasts a 25-meter-tall observation tower which allows visitors to gaze upon large swathes of the country. Tourists interested in the historical background of the location will also find the Merkine visitor center, the Merkine Regional Museum and the Merkine Cross Hill. Furthermore, for those who want to explore surrounding nature, the local government has established cycling trail near the historical sites. This combination of all kinds of attractions are what drives thousands of tourists to visit the area each year.

The new tender of the grounds has stated that they want to make Merkine Manor even better. It will provide accommodations to everyone visiting and will focus its culinary menu on traditional local and Lithuanian cuisine.

The mayor of Varena District Municipality, Algis Kašėje, was eager to point out that one of the factors contributing to the area’s touristic success is its great strategic location. “It is easily accessible from Vilnius and Kaunas, near the popular Druskininkai and near the Polish border. We hope that in the objects once visited and lived by kings and princes, …, we will soon be able to enjoy not only the revived historical buildings but also the tourists”.
